Will aging populations lead to a housing glut? Laura Kusisto, reporter at The Wall Street Journal, argues that generational churn will leave houses – and in fact, whole neighborhoods – empty as baby boomers age and millennials flock to coastal cities and refuse to replace them. Kusisto argues that these demographic changes could cause a chronic oversupply of housing that will have profound impacts on the economy and society. Filmed on December 10, 2019 in New York.
